Microsoft Edge Chromium Microsoft’s browser is a project that uses the Chromium kernel, so you can use extensions / extensions from the Google Chrome browser.
Its similarities with Google Chrome are quite large, except for the marked more of the interface and less obvious rounded edges. In terms of memory consumption and CPU usage are fairly uniform with the same Google Chrome and you can hardly notice the difference.
Google Chrome, Opera, Vivaldi or Yandex, they are all different browsers, but they also have a common base: Chromium. This is an open source project created by Google and is actually the most basic part of the browser, its tools and facilities. As a result, you might think Chrome is a modified version of Chromium for which Google has added its own specific codecs, plugins, and options.
However, all browsers use Chromium as a basis, sharing some common aspects. For example, everyone can use the same extension category, and although some browsers decide to include their own extension stores for more personal control over what What they provide, they can eventually install third parties.
This popularity of Chromium has caused several other companies trying to use their own tools for their browsers to surrender. The last one was informed by Mircosoft that they would make Edge use Chromium, although there are still some other browsers like Firefox trying to resist.
Therefore, for practical purposes, Microsoft Edge Chromium 2020 means you can use Chrome extensions and many pages optimized for the Google browser will start to be better used in Edge. Both browsers will go from direct competition to simpler, shared cousins, although Microsoft may still improve it in its own way to make it stand out.
